首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

绘制两个函数依赖值的“关系”

函数依赖是数据库设计中的一个重要概念,用于描述一个关系中的属性之间的依赖关系。在绘制两个函数依赖值的关系时,可以采用以下步骤:

  1. 确定关系中的属性:首先,需要确定这两个函数依赖值所属的关系,并确定关系中的属性。假设关系中有属性A、B、C和D。
  2. 确定函数依赖:根据给定的函数依赖值,确定属性之间的依赖关系。函数依赖可以分为两种类型:完全函数依赖和部分函数依赖。
    • 完全函数依赖:如果属性A依赖于属性B,且属性B是唯一决定属性A的属性,则称属性A完全函数依赖于属性B。表示为B → A。
    • 部分函数依赖:如果属性A依赖于属性B,但属性B不是唯一决定属性A的属性,则称属性A部分函数依赖于属性B。表示为B →> A。
  • 绘制函数依赖图:根据确定的函数依赖关系,可以绘制函数依赖图。函数依赖图使用箭头表示依赖关系,箭头的起点表示决定属性,箭头的终点表示被决定属性。
  • 例如,如果有函数依赖A → B和B → C,则可以绘制如下的函数依赖图:
  • 例如,如果有函数依赖A → B和B → C,则可以绘制如下的函数依赖图:
  • 分析函数依赖:根据函数依赖图,可以进行函数依赖的分析。可以通过分析函数依赖来优化数据库设计,消除冗余数据和更新异常。

绘制函数依赖值的关系是数据库设计中的重要步骤,可以帮助我们理清属性之间的依赖关系,从而更好地设计和优化数据库结构。

关于云计算和IT互联网领域的名词词汇,以下是一些常见的相关概念和推荐的腾讯云产品:

  • 云计算:云计算是一种通过网络提供计算资源和服务的模式,包括云服务器、存储、数据库、网络等。腾讯云产品:云服务器、云数据库、对象存储等。腾讯云产品介绍
  • 前端开发:前端开发是指开发网站或应用程序的用户界面部分,包括HTML、CSS和JavaScript等技术。腾讯云产品:云开发、CDN加速等。腾讯云云开发
  • 后端开发:后端开发是指开发网站或应用程序的服务器端部分,包括处理业务逻辑、数据库操作等。腾讯云产品:云函数、云数据库等。腾讯云云函数
  • 软件测试:软件测试是指对软件进行验证和验证的过程,以确保其符合预期的功能和质量要求。腾讯云产品:云测试、移动测试等。腾讯云移动测试
  • 数据库:数据库是用于存储和管理数据的系统,包括关系型数据库和非关系型数据库等。腾讯云产品:云数据库MySQL、云数据库MongoDB等。腾讯云云数据库
  • 服务器运维:服务器运维是指管理和维护服务器的工作,包括配置、监控、故障排除等。腾讯云产品:云监控、云服务器等。腾讯云云服务器
  • 云原生:云原生是一种构建和运行在云环境中的应用程序的方法论,包括容器化、微服务等。腾讯云产品:容器服务、云原生应用平台等。腾讯云容器服务
  • 网络通信:网络通信是指通过网络进行数据传输和交流的过程,包括TCP/IP协议、HTTP协议等。腾讯云产品:私有网络、弹性公网IP等。腾讯云私有网络
  • 网络安全:网络安全是保护计算机网络和系统免受未经授权的访问、破坏或泄露的措施。腾讯云产品:云安全中心、Web应用防火墙等。腾讯云云安全中心
  • 音视频:音视频是指音频和视频的处理和传输,包括音频编解码、视频编解码等。腾讯云产品:实时音视频、点播等。腾讯云实时音视频
  • 多媒体处理:多媒体处理是指对多媒体数据进行编辑、转码、剪辑等处理。腾讯云产品:云点播、云剪等。腾讯云云点播
  • 人工智能:人工智能是指使计算机具备类似人类智能的能力,包括机器学习、自然语言处理等。腾讯云产品:人工智能机器学习平台、智能语音交互等。腾讯云人工智能
  • 物联网:物联网是指通过互联网连接和管理物理设备的网络,包括传感器、物联网平台等。腾讯云产品:物联网通信、物联网开发平台等。腾讯云物联网通信
  • 移动开发:移动开发是指开发移动应用程序的过程,包括Android开发、iOS开发等。腾讯云产品:移动推送、移动分析等。腾讯云移动推送
  • 存储:存储是指存储和管理数据的过程,包括对象存储、文件存储等。腾讯云产品:对象存储、文件存储等。腾讯云对象存储
  • 区块链:区块链是一种去中心化的分布式账本技术,用于记录交易和数据。腾讯云产品:区块链服务、区块链托管服务等。腾讯云区块链服务
  • 元宇宙:元宇宙是指虚拟世界和现实世界的融合,包括虚拟现实、增强现实等技术。腾讯云产品:虚拟现实、增强现实等。腾讯云虚拟现实

请注意,以上推荐的腾讯云产品仅供参考,具体的选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共49个视频
动力节点-MyBatis框架入门到实战教程
动力节点Java培训
Maven是Apache软件基金会组织维护的一款自动化构建工具,专注服务于Java平台的项目构建和依赖管理。Maven 是目前最流行的自动化构建工具,对于生产环境下多框架、多模块整合开发有重要作用,Maven 是一款在大型项目开发过程中不可或缺的重要工具,Maven通过一小段描述信息可以整合多个项目之间的引用关系,提供规范的管理各个常用jar包及其各个版本,并且可以自动下载和引入项目中。
领券